Zulu time is used by military forces, aviation, and meteorology professionals. It is another name for Coordinated Universal Time (UTC), helping ensure synchronized operations across different time zones, enhancing efficiency and reducing misunderstandings in multinational operations.

- What is Zulu time? Zulu time is another name for Coordinated Universal Time (UTC), a time standard used worldwide to ensure consistent timekeeping.
- Why do military forces use Zulu time? Military forces use Zulu time to coordinate operations across different time zones without confusion, ensuring synchronized actions globally.
- How is Zulu time used in aviation? In aviation, Zulu time standardizes flight plans, air traffic control, and navigation by using a single reference time regardless of local zones.
- What role does Zulu time play in meteorology? Meteorologists use Zulu time to accurately timestamp weather data and forecasts, allowing consistent communication across regions and countries.
